Comparison Table of Keno Strategies
| Strategy | Pros | Cons |
|---|---|---|
| Betting on Fewer Numbers | Higher chances of winning small amounts | Lower payouts |
| Betting on More Numbers | Potential for larger wins | Lower odds of hitting all selected numbers |
| Using a Pattern | Engaging and can make the game more enjoyable | No statistical advantage |
